18 /*
19  * signals
20  */
21 
22 #include <signal.h>
23 #include <errno.h>
24 
25 #include <pthread.h>
26 
27 #include "thread/rthread.h"
28 #include "cancel.h"		/* in libc/include */
29 
30 int
sigwait(const sigset_t * set,int * sig)31 sigwait(const sigset_t *set, int *sig)
32 {
33 	sigset_t s = *set;
34 	int ret;
35 
36 	sigdelset(&s, SIGTHR);
37 	do {
38 		ENTER_CANCEL_POINT(1);
39 		ret = __thrsigdivert(s, NULL, NULL);
40 		LEAVE_CANCEL_POINT(ret == -1);
41 	} while (ret == -1 && errno == EINTR);
42 	if (ret == -1)
43 		return (errno);
44 	*sig = ret;
45 	return (0);
46 }
